Transaction 8cb66efb7115be054d5a59c8018fcc1bf3ec40181cc56e4b6486f81f77de8dd0
1 Input
1 Output
-
8cb66efb7115be054d5a59c8018fcc1bf3ec40181cc56e4b6486f81f77de8dd0:0
- value
- 903745
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 63d4ed0fd4ef4327668f8aae359ae84a90cbe8d5 OP_EQUAL
- address
- 3AnsttpzbhWZQA7L8jKLQyE7CTuDw6s3GF